Introduction of the Swedish Driver's License
Sweden's driver's license is a document that licenses the holder's capability to drive an automobile according to Swedish laws and regulations. The license is issued by the Swedish Transport Agency (Transportstyrelsen) and is required for anyone who wishes to run a motor automobile in the country. The Swedish driver's license system is created to be comprehensive, ensuring that all motorists are well-prepared and knowledgeable about the guidelines of the roadway.

Driving in Sweden: Key Points to keep in mind
1. Roadway Rules
- Right of Way: In Sweden, motorists on the right have the right-of-way at crossways, unless otherwise indicated by indications.
- Speed Limits: The basic speed limit in city areas is 50 km/h (31 mph), while on highways it is 110 km/h (68 mph) or 120 km/h (75 miles per hour) on some motorways.
- Alcohol Limits: The legal blood alcohol limit for chauffeurs is 0.2 per mille, which is very low compared to numerous other countries.
2. Roadway Signs and Markings
- Roundabouts: Sweden has a high number of roundabouts, and it's essential to understand the rules for entering and leaving them.
- Concern Road Signs: Pay attention to concern roadway indications, which show the access at crossways.
3. Lorry Requirements
- Car Insurance: All lorries in Sweden need to have third-party liability insurance coverage.
- Winter season Tires: During the winter months (October to April), it is mandatory to utilize winter season tires.
4. Environmental Considerations
- Eco-Driving: Sweden motivates eco-driving practices to decrease emissions and promote sustainability.
- Low-Emission Zones: Some cities, consisting of Stockholm, have low-emission zones where only cars that fulfill certain emission standards are allowed.
